Hi, On Mon, Feb 9, 2009 at 5:13 PM, Michael Parmeley <[email protected]> wrote: > Can ApacheDS 1.0 be installed on a linux box that doesn't have X11? I > find this requirement odd as surely the most common use case for > installing the server is installing it on a backend server that neither > has nor needs any GUI access. (like a blade server sitting in a data > center somewhere)
Two things : 1) We engage you to install the 1.5.4 version, as it's way better than 1.0.2. It has a command line installer too. 2) The 1.0.2 has a RPM installer, which should be what you need. If you are on a debian based Linux, you may want to use alien to convert it to a deb packet. 3) In any case, you still can install it on a server having a X11 interface, and then copy the installed files on your server (a bit paifull, but it works).
